About this map

Hillsboro and Wilmington anchor this mid-1980s landscape, where the flat agricultural plains of western Ohio meet the rising hills of the Allegheny Plateau. The map reveals a transition from the rectangular township grids of Clinton Co and Highland Co to the more varied, wooded topography of the Shawnee State Forest and Pike State Forest in the southeast. Transportation is a central theme, with the Baltimore and Ohio Railroad and Norfolk and Western Railway cutting across the terrain, connecting industrial centers like Chillicothe and Greenfield.
